Hello all, To celebrate the upcoming Rolex 24hrs at Daytona, we will be doing a 2hrs at Daytona on Sunday Feb 5th. ![]() Car Restrictions None, however race cars are recommended Tuning Restrictions: 650pp Event Settings: -Grid Start with False Start Check -Grid Order: Slowest First -Visible Damage: On -Penalty: none -Race Finish Delay: 120 Seconds -Mechanical Damage: Heavy -Slipstream Strength: Low -Tire Wear / Fuel Consumption: On -Grip Reduction on Wet Track / Track Edge: Real -No ASM -No Skid Recovery Force -No Active Steering Schedule - Sunday Feb 5th 7:30 - 8:00 - Practice 8:00 - 8:15 - Qualifying 8:15 - 10:15 - Race Damage Please note that damage will be: OFF for Practice LIGHT for Qualifying HEAVY for Race (requiring you to pit to fix damage) Bluetooth Headsets Strongly Recommended! I can't stress that enough! Any Bluetooth headset will work, just make sure to pair it with your PS3. Futureshop has a good selection as well. Prizes 1st Place - Gold Corvette ZR1 RM (Fully Tuned) / Gold 2nd Place - Silver Corvette Z06 RM (Stock) / Silver 3rd Place - Bronze -Camaro SS RM (Stock) / Matte Black Any questions please let me know. |

Due to the length of this race, if any person "drops" and manages to get back into the room, we will "red flag" the race at that time. The Red Flag procedure will be proceed to the front straight but behind the start/finish line. -The current time index will be taken. -In current order, cars will pass the start/finish line to see if any cars are 1 lap behind the leader or more. -This will be noted for the restart. -The car that dropped will be considered to be placed 1 lap behind the last place car. (Call this mechanical difficulties). -The time index taken at the beginning of the red flag will be used to calculate the remaining time of the race. -The race will be restarted, however the first lap will be used to get the cars into proper order. First place car will lead as a "pace car" for 1 lap. No cars may change positions until after crossing the start/finish line for the formation lap. (This procedure is something completely new for us, and I'm open to suggestions before we put what is above in place) |
